从未打开的工作簿中提取和编辑数据到现有工作簿

时间:2016-10-18 10:32:22

标签: excel vba excel-vba csv excel-external-data

我需要帮助从几个现有工作簿(.csv)中提取和编辑数据,并将这些数据放入一个工作簿中。

首先,我将下载我想要添加到"主要工作簿"的.cvs工作簿的数量。这些下载的.csv工作簿都包含一张数据,并且都将存储在同一个地图中; XPO_SupplyMutations

接下来我希望宏将每个工作簿中的数据一个接一个地逐页添加到主工作簿中,并按顺序(数字可能或按日期添加到地图中),但是,在添加数据之前从工作簿到新工作表,它还需要将每个工作簿的J列中的数据转换为字符串而不是值,因为它包含超过15个字符,我需要所有18个字符相同而不区分。 '我认为这称为从外部数据导入

总结:

(用户执行此操作):下载需要从中提取数据的工作簿(所需的所有数据都位于工作表1上,每个下载的工作簿都是相同的)

(用户这样做):拖动&将所有这些下载的工作簿删除或保存到地图中:XPO_SupplyMutations

(宏执行此操作):在现有主工作簿中创建新工作表并添加第一个工作簿中的数据

(宏执行此操作):在将数据添加到新工作表之前,需要将J列中的单元格转换为文本'我相信这称为导入外部数据????

(宏执行此操作):重复上述操作,直到映射中的所有工作簿都满足并使用XPO_SupplyMutations。

0 个答案:

没有答案